TNXB-Related Disorders: A Qualitative Evidence Synthesis and Proposal for Reclassification as a Muscle-ECM Interface Disorder

2026-01-08

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background: </h4> TNXB-related classical-like Ehlers-Danlos syndrome (clEDS) is caused by biallelic pathogenic variants in TNXB, encoding the extracellular matrix glycoprotein tenascin-X.
